Nektar++
Classes | Namespaces | Macros | Typedefs | Functions
TimeIntegrationScheme.h File Reference
#include <string>
#include <boost/core/ignore_unused.hpp>
#include <LibUtilities/BasicUtils/ErrorUtil.hpp>
#include <LibUtilities/BasicUtils/NekFactory.hpp>
#include <LibUtilities/BasicConst/NektarUnivTypeDefs.hpp>
#include <LibUtilities/BasicUtils/SharedArray.hpp>
#include <LibUtilities/LibUtilitiesDeclspec.h>
#include <LibUtilities/TimeIntegration/TimeIntegrationSchemeOperators.h>
#include <LibUtilities/TimeIntegration/TimeIntegrationTypes.hpp>

Go to the source code of this file.

Classes

class  Nektar::LibUtilities::TimeIntegrationScheme
 Base class for time integration schemes. More...
 

Namespaces

 Nektar
 The above copyright notice and this permission notice shall be included.
 
 Nektar::LibUtilities
 

Macros

#define LUE   LIB_UTILITIES_EXPORT
 

Typedefs

typedef NekFactory< std::string, TimeIntegrationScheme, std::string, unsigned int, std::vector< NekDouble > > Nektar::LibUtilities::TimeIntegrationSchemeFactory
 Datatype of the NekFactory used to instantiate classes derived from the EquationSystem class. More...
 

Functions

TimeIntegrationSchemeFactory & Nektar::LibUtilities::GetTimeIntegrationSchemeFactory ()
 
std::ostream & Nektar::LibUtilities::operator<< (std::ostream &os, const TimeIntegrationScheme &rhs)
 
std::ostream & Nektar::LibUtilities::operator<< (std::ostream &os, const TimeIntegrationSchemeSharedPtr &rhs)
 

Macro Definition Documentation

◆ LUE

#define LUE   LIB_UTILITIES_EXPORT

Definition at line 53 of file TimeIntegrationScheme.h.